Female sex drive can be as strong as male, but it operates very differently. Male sex drive is mostly about what's happening in the genitals: more stored fluid in the seminal vesicles makes you horny. But in women it is much more about what's going on in the brain. If a woman is upset or angry, her sex drive simply turns off, like flipping a switch. Men often misinterpret this as "withholding sex", but it isn't that at all. If you imagine that any time you're feeling angry or upset you get a feeling like post nut clarity, but about ten times as strong - it's more like that.

Both drives are affected by hormones, of course, but women on a much slower rhythm. Women have two sexual peaks a month, one at ovulation, and one either just before or during her period. Men have six or seven peaks and troughs per day.

Men generally have a greater desire for sex when they're not having it, but women have a greater capacity for sex when they *are* having it. It's not unusual for a woman to have a dozen or more orgasms in one session - not many men can manage more than one without having to take a break.

Female sex drive is also a bit more focused while men's is more indiscriminate: men can experience the feeling of wanting sex and not really caring who it's with. Women never feel that; but they can want sex just as much, so long as it's with a specific person they're attracted to.
